Komfo Anokye Teaching Hospital CEO sues lawyer for defamation, seeks GH¢5 million in damages

Chief Executive Officer of Komfo Anokye Teaching Hospital (KATH), Prof. Otchere Addai-Mensah, has filed a defamation lawsuit against Lawyer Kwame Adofo, seeking GH¢5 million in damages. The lawsuit, filed at the high court on Monday, May 27, states that Prof. Adofo made false and damaging statements that have severely tarnished Prof. Addai-Mensah’s personal and professional reputation.
